Verod-Kepple Africa Ventures Raises $43 Million for Pan-African Venture Fund

BY Tom Jackson

Verod-Kepple Africa Ventures (VKAV) has raised US$43 million for its pan-African venture fund, which invests in scalable, tech-enabled, post-revenue startups addressing difficult challenges on the continent.

Formed in 2021 as a joint venture between Kepple Africa Ventures (KAV), a Japanese venture capital firm, and Verod Holdings (Verod), an African growth capital private equity firm, VKAV is led by partners Satoshi Shinada, Ryosuke Yamawaki, and Ory Okolloh.
